Ornamental Grasses - Pennisetum Alpecuroides Hameln

A beautiful loosely tufted, low-growing grass producing dark green leaves that are tinged with purple, and attractive arching brown bottle-brush flower heads. Prefers a sunny position and a well-drained soil. Flowers July-September. Needs winter protection

Product Description

A beautiful loosely tufted, low-growing grass producing dark green leaves that are tinged with violet, & attractive arching brown bottle-brush flower heads. Prefers a sunny position & a well-drained soil. Flowers July-September. Needs winter protection in colder areas. Height 70cm. These easy-to-grow, hardy plants will bring a light, airy feel to your garden, providing structure & contrast to other flowers, together with a dynamic movement as they ripple in the slightest breeze. & don't be tempted to cut them down in autumn

Suttons Seeds
Suttons Seeds are an internationally renowned supplier of all types of seeds for fruit and vegetables. Originally founded in 1806 by John Sutton it is now based in Paignton.
